Description

Guru Speed Carbon Floats, The Speed is a pattern designed for catching large numbers of fish, a stable pattern that sets and settles very quickly, enabling a bite to be seen as soon as the bait settles, perfect for use with a bulked-down style positive rig. The fast-setting nature of this float comes from the fact that it is a body-down design, with the body tapered in a teardrop shape with the bottom of the body rounder for stability and the top part of the body tapering up smoothly to the bristle. This shape also means the float is perfect for lowering down into the water when using baits like bloodworm or bread punch and strikes incredibly cleanly from the water. The fibreglass tips are highly sensitive, but unlike on many silverfish style floats, we have introduced a slightly thicker tip so they are clearly visible, especially on the smaller sizes that are likely to be used in tough light conditions on small canals and drains. Variations of wire and carbon stems in all sizes mean anglers have options of super stable floats in wire for tricky conditions, and carbon versions for quicker fishing to reduce tangles. Huge amounts of attention and lots of alterations have been made to the lengths and diameters of stems and bristles, so each size is unique and perfect for the situation in hand. The key feature that sets this range of floats aside from anything we or others have ever produced before is the Elastilex Paint Finish, giving the floats ultimate strength, durability and longevity. This finish means the high-quality balsa bodies of the float are protected by a super thin and incredibly durable elastic coating that wraps the body, preventing any damage to the body from wear, impact or line-cutting into it, further reducing the chances of the floats taking on water. The paint finish is dark in colour, which our key anglers felt was important with these floats been used on clear, natural venues, the dark body blending onto the water enabling ultimate focus on the Hi-Viz bristles.
